Built to Love


Jesus replied: "'Love the Lord your God with all your heart and with all your soul and with all your mind.  This is the first and greatest commandment. And the second is like it: 'Love your neighbor as yourself."'  Matthew 22:37-39
It is very clear that the essence of scripture is Love.  Through Love we have a relationship with Jesus Christ and can celebrate his birthday this weekend as our Lord and Savior. The question for us this week is, "Do our relationships mirror the scripture above?"  Love and relationships can at times be a challenging proposition for us men.  However, I haven’t found any gender exclusion in this scripture so we were built and designed to Love.  (Psalm 139:13)
A very good friend passed away this past week and I cried for the first time in I don’t know how long and it felt very manly.  I was very thankful that I had developed a good enough relationship with another man that I could honestly say I loved him and would miss him.  Relationships like these are what we are to have and to cherish, with our families, our friends and most of all, our God. 
This Christmas the gift that I want to give to all of my family and friends is Love.  After all, that is the most important gift that we have been given.  Imagine, we don’t have to fight crowds to purchase this gift, but we might just draw crowds by giving it.
